Python/Объектно-ориентированное программирование на Python: различия между версиями

Содержимое удалено Содержимое добавлено
м →‎Принципы ООП: избыточное уточнение про питон
Строка 6:
Согласно [[Кей, Алан|Алану Кэю]] — автору языка программирования [[Smalltalk]] — объектно-ориентированным может называться язык, построенный с учетом следующих принципов<ref name="alan kay oop principles">[http://www.cs.aau.dk/~torp/Teaching/E02/OOP/handouts/introduction.pdf Introduction to Object-Oriented Programming]</ref>:
 
* Все данные представляются объектами Python
* Программа является набором взаимодействующих объектов, посылающих друг другу сообщения
* Каждый объект имеет собственную часть памяти и может иметь в составе другие объекты